In a small neighborhood 5 minutes walk from Sirmione Castle and on the shores of a lake with garden and pier for exclusive use residence for sale one bedroom apartment on the second floor with elevator, terrace with stunning views, bathroom with window and double bedroom with terrace. Excellent finishes, parquet flooring in the living room and bedroom, air conditioning and alarm system. Garage in the basement served by a car elevator.
